Newly promoted French Ligue 1 side Paris FC have offered Nigeria international winger Moses Simon a three year deal with a monthly salary of €300,000 (600 million Naira) a month, twice what he is presently earning at fellow French Ligue 1 side Nantes, OwnGoalNigeria.com reports.
Paris FC aim is to make the 29 year old their statement signing in the wake of the takeover by the arnault family and the Red Bull brand. Simon has already said yes to their proposal.
Nantes have been locked in talks over his transfer, and after initially refusing an opening offer of €5m , both teams are said to be closing in on an agreement for €6m potentially rising to €8m with add ons.
Reports of an agreement and a proposed medical is wide off the mark as the winger isn’t even in France at the moment. He left Nigeria one week ago for holiday with his family.
The figure is close to the valuation that Nantes have of the forward who has just a year left on his deal after spending five years at the club. Last season he had ten assists with eight goals from 32 games.
Simon is presently on holiday with his family, and he is expected to return to Nigeria next week but might likely complete the move before coming home for the concluding part of his holiday.
